MVR, or mechanical vapor recompression, is a cutting-edge energy-conservation technology designed to significantly reduce the reliance on external energy sources. This is achieved through the ingenious reuse of secondary steam energy it generates. The core principle involves compressing the secondary steam produced by the evaporator using a highly efficient steam compressor, effectively transforming electrical energy into thermal energy. This process results in increased pressure and temperature of the secondary steam. The temperature elevation then allows the secondary steam to be redirected back to the evaporator, where it heats the materials, inducing evaporation. This cycle brilliantly recycles the latent heat of vaporization of secondary steam, optimizing energy usage in an eco-friendly manner.
The DM series Single-stage geard steam compressor is engineered with precision and includes several critical components: the compressor body itself, a coupling, a gearbox, a lubrication system, a motor, an electric instrument, and a state-of-the-art anti-surge control system. Designed for efficiency, it features a compact structure that not only enhances its performance but also ensures ease of maintenance, making it an ideal choice for modern industrial applications.
3.3.1 Begin by seamlessly integrating the compressor base onto its solid foundation. Carefully place wedge-shaped shims beneath the base for unit-level adjustment. This meticulous approach ensures precision and stability.
Alternate the placement of two wedge-shaped irons to maintain balance. Once the leveling is achieved, spot weld these wedges in 4 to 5 strategic points, securing them firmly in place.
The user should craft and install the wedges tailored to the specific installation context. Ensure that the contact surfaces are finely finished for even contact on inclined planes,
with a bearing capacity not exceeding 40Kg/cm2).
3.3.2 Employ a precision level to achieve perfect balance. The unit's axial level should be 0.05/1000mm, while the horizontal level is maintained at 0.10/1000mm, reflecting the utmost precision.
level of the unit is 0.10/1000mm.
3.3.3 Center the coupling with precision. Prior to alignment, ensure these vital steps are undertaken:
1) Deactivate the main power supply for safety;
2) Detach the coupling shield to access components;
3) Remove the diaphragm coupling's intermediate segment;
4) Verify the motor installation plane is level and free from debris, dirt, or obstructions;
5) Ensure motor bolt holes exceed bolt sizes, allowing for bolt loosening during motor adjustment;
6) Prepare ample flat, stainless steel gaskets to support the motor foot. These should be spotless and flat, avoiding long, thin gaskets which can distort adjustments.
7) Use a dial indicator or laser alignment meter, with a precise accuracy of 0.01mm, supplied by the customer;
8) Ready the bracket to support the dial indicator, as illustrated below;
9) Employ a motor wheel hub mounting bracket for dial indicator placement along the hub's edge, ensuring the probe touches the compressor wheel hub's outer rim;
10) Adjust the motor foot bolts carefully so that the compressor and motor center lines align, with a maximum deviation on the outer circle of 0.05mm. The motor shaft center should exceed the compressor's low-speed shaft center line, with coupling end face deviation between 0.03~0.05mm.
11) Securely tighten the motor foot bolts, then double-check for any outer circle runout and end face runout of the coupling;
12) Post motor idling test, reinstall the coupling's intermediate section.
3.3.4 With 'levelness' and alignment confirmed, firmly tighten the anchor bolts. Post-mechanical operation or trial run, release the bolts and tighten them anew for reinforced security.
3.3.5 As the impeller spins at high speeds, any ingress of solids or liquids can irreparably damage the compressor. Ensure the connecting pipelines are pristine and adhere to the steam corrosion standards. Should discrepancies exist, initiate pipeline rectifications. It's recommended to integrate solid-liquid separation systems like gas scrubbers or sedimentation tees prior to the compressor inlet's straight pipe.uggested to add solid liquid separation equipment (gas scrubber or sedimentation tee) before the straight pipe at the compressor inlet.
3.3.6 Proceed with the installation of compressor inlet and outlet pipes. These pipelines must include all necessary accessories as per the PI diagram. The supporting bracket, separate from the compressor, must bear the pipeline's weight, avoiding undue stress on the compressor body.

3.3.8 Position the electric control cabinet of the compressor within a convenient 5-meter range from the compressor itself. To ensure a seamless connection, utilize threading pipes to connect the wiring from the compressor to the cabinet, threading these connections underground for an unobtrusive setup. After positioning the electric control cabinet, meticulously link the wiring terminals within it to the remote DCS lines, ensuring a harmonious integration with the system's broader control framework.

1. Heat Pump Distillation: Perfectly crafted to enhance efficiency in heat transfer and distillation processes, ensuring maximum energy utilization.
2. Waste Heat Recovery: Innovatively designed to capture and reuse waste heat, drastically reducing energy waste and boosting overall operational performance.
3. Environmental Protection Field: Our Compressors excel in industrial wastewater treatment, lithium battery wastewater management, and wastewater recycling. They are adept at treating landfill leachate, separating sodium and potassium in fly ash leachate from waste incineration, and much more, making them indispensable for sustainable environmental management.
4. Lithium-Ion Battery Industry: Tailored for the lithium-ion sector, our devices support a range of processes, including salt lake lithium extraction, iron phosphate processing, and wastewater treatment from battery disassembly and nickel battery cycling.
5. New Energy Industry: Specifically developed for photovoltaic and polycrystalline silicon wastewater treatment, these compressors play a pivotal role in facilitating the eco-friendly operations of the new energy sector.
6. Food & Beverage Industry: Specially optimized for the concentration and extraction of amino acids like alanine, as well as the drying and concentration of sugar liquids and beverage jams, ensuring high quality in food and beverage production.
7. Pharmaceutical Industry: Expertly engineered for evaporation, concentration, crystallization, and drying processes in the production of both traditional Chinese and Western medicines, enhancing efficiency and product quality.
8. Chemical Industry: Our advanced technology supports the polymerization of caprolactam, polylactic acid (PLA) production, nylon 66 manufacturing, chelating agent evaporation, mannitol concentration, anhydrous sodium sulfate crystallization, and other critical chemical processes.
9. Metallurgical Industry: Provides effective solutions for treating wastewater from sintering desulfurization, coking operations, vanadium extraction processes, and smelting activities, contributing to cleaner metallurgical practices.
10. Power Industry: Specialized in the treatment of desulfurized wastewater from power stations, ensuring compliance with environmental standards and enhancing plant efficiency.
